For the problem that the linear scale of intrusion signals in the optical fiber pre-warning system (OFPS) is inconsistent, this paper presents a method to correct the scale. Firstly, the intrusion signals are intercepted, and an aggregate of the segments with equal length is obtained. Then, the Mellin transform (MT) is applied to convert them into the same scale. The spectral characteristics are obtained by the Fourier transform. Finally, we adopt back-propagation (BP) neural network to identify intrusion types, which takes the spectral characteristics as input. We carried out the field experiments and collected the optical fiber intrusion signals which contain the picking signal, shoveling signal, and running signal. The experimental results show that the proposed algorithm can effectively improve the recognition accuracy of the intrusion signals. 展开更多

Introduction: Although the Brief Psychiatric Rating Scale (BPRS) is widely used for evaluating patients with schizophrenia, the meaning of the weights of the individual symptoms is ambiguous. The aims of the study were 1) to investigate whether the modification of relative weights of items of the BPRS is able to enhance its correlation with the Clinical Global Impression-Schizophrenia scale (CGI-SCH) and 2) to construct a potential modified BPRS. Methods: We evaluated 200 schizophrenia patients using the BPRS and the CGI-SCH and drew the scatter plot distributions of the two scales. Next, univariate regression for the CGI-SCH using individual symptoms of the BPRS was performed. Multivariate regression utilizing the ‘logistic function’ was then conducted to allocate marks to each item and Pearson’s r correlation coefficient and r-squared between the two scales were assessed. After that, we constructed an example of a potential modified BPRS. Results: With the scatter plot for the two scales, a logarithmic curve was obtained;this was described by [CGI-SCH] = 3.2248 × ln[18-item BPRS] – 7.2044 (p i” that could express the relative weights of individual symptoms. Subsequently, modification of point allocations according to “Pi” yielded a Pearson’s r of 0.8491 and an r-squared of 0.7718 (not changed) (both p < 0.001). An example of a potential modified BPRS was constructed. Conclusions: Within the limits of our data, the weightings of items of the BPRS improved the correlation of the BPRS with the CGI-SCH for evaluating schizophrenia. 展开更多

The purpose of this study was to examine the burnout levels of research assistants in Ondokuz Mayis University and to examine the results of multiple linear regression model based on the results obtained from Maslach Burnout Scale with Jackknife Method in terms of validity and generalizability. To do this, a questionnaire was given to 11 research assistants working at Ondokuz Mayis University and the burnout scores of this questionnaire were taken as the dependent variable of the multiple linear regression model. The variable of burnout was explained with the variables of age, weekly hours of classes taught, monthly average credit card debt, numbers of published articles and reports, gender, marital status, number of children and the departments of the research assistants. Dummy variables were assigned to the variables of gender, marital status, number of children and the departments of the research assistants and thus, they were made quantitative. The significance of the model as a result of multiple linear regressions was examined through backward elimination method. After this, for the five explanatory variables which influenced the variable of burnout, standardized model coefficients and coefficients of determination, and 95% confidence intervals of these values were estimated through Jackknife Method and the generalizability of the parameter estimation results of these variables on population was researched. 展开更多

Time-delays,due to the information transmission between subsystems,naturally exist in large-scale systems and the existence of the delay is frequently a source of instability. This paper considers the problems of robust non-fragile fuzzy control for a class of uncertain discrete nonlinear large-scale systems with time-delay and controller gain perturbations described by T-S fuzzy model. An equivalent T-S fuzzy model is represented for discrete-delay nonlinear large-scale systems. A sufficient condition for the existence of such non-fragile controllers is further derived via the Lyapunov function and the linear matrix inequality( LMI) approach. Simulation results demonstrate the feasibility and the effectiveness of the proposed design and the proper stabilization of the system in spite of controller gain variations and uncertainties. 展开更多

Elementary information theory is used to model cybersecurity complexity, where the model assumes that security risk management is a binomial stochastic process. Complexity is shown to increase exponentially with the number of vulnerabilities in combination with security risk management entropy. However, vulnerabilities can be either local or non-local, where the former is confined to networked elements and the latter results from interactions between elements. Furthermore, interactions involve multiple methods of communication, where each method can contain vulnerabilities specific to that method. Importantly, the number of possible interactions scales quadratically with the number of elements in standard network topologies. Minimizing these interactions can significantly reduce the number of vulnerabilities and the accompanying complexity. Two network configurations that yield sub-quadratic and linear scaling relations are presented. 展开更多

为支撑岩土、隧道工程中的岩石选样及现场施工的岩石强度测试,研究利用小尺度滚刀直线切割试验反推岩石强度。从隧道工程现场和岩石矿场采集单轴抗压强度为50~230 MPa的岩石试样共9批次,制备棒状和块状试样并分别开展单轴压缩、巴西劈... 为支撑岩土、隧道工程中的岩石选样及现场施工的岩石强度测试,研究利用小尺度滚刀直线切割试验反推岩石强度。从隧道工程现场和岩石矿场采集单轴抗压强度为50~230 MPa的岩石试样共9批次,制备棒状和块状试样并分别开展单轴压缩、巴西劈裂和小尺度滚刀直线切割试验;选取其中7批次试验数据,分别得到单轴抗压强度、劈裂抗拉强度与直线切割试验的法向力均值、峰值及峰均值的拟合函数,用剩余2批次试验结果验证所得预测模型的准确性。结果表明:岩石单轴抗压强度与法向载荷的拟合相关系数大于0.9,劈裂抗拉强度与法向载荷的拟合相关系数大于0.8,说明岩石强度与切割载荷成强线性相关性;验证试验发现,利用法向力均值、峰均值验证时,岩石单轴抗压强度的预测值与试验值误差小于5%,劈裂抗拉强度的预测值与试验值误差小于10%,说明所建模型具有较高的准确性。使用本研究所提出的试验方法及所建模型,可以快速准确地预估岩石试样的强度,为室内试验时岩石采样和现场施工时岩石强度评估提供了一种有效的手段。 展开更多

通过对SUS436L超纯铁素体不锈钢冷板表面常见等间隔纵向线状缺陷微观分析和中试轧制试验,明确了热轧过程残留氧化铁鳞在轧制后压入基体是导致线状缺陷的主要原因。该缺陷呈现规律性间隔,主要与铸坯修磨磨痕有关,通过调整加热炉加热温度... 通过对SUS436L超纯铁素体不锈钢冷板表面常见等间隔纵向线状缺陷微观分析和中试轧制试验,明确了热轧过程残留氧化铁鳞在轧制后压入基体是导致线状缺陷的主要原因。该缺陷呈现规律性间隔,主要与铸坯修磨磨痕有关,通过调整加热炉加热温度和优化铸坯修磨工艺可明显改善此类缺陷。 展开更多
